Cypress Park Tarpon is a tight, single-era build: every home in the community dates to a narrow 2002-2005 window, with a median build year of 2003. That consistency in construction age is the defining feature of this market — buyers are comparing homes of similar vintage and similar systems age rather than sorting through decades of mixed-era inventory.
With only 59 homes in the community, the pool is small enough that a handful of listings can shift the tenor of the market at any given time. A high share of homes are homesteaded, which points to longer average hold periods and fewer properties cycling onto the market in a given year — worth factoring into how long a buyer may need to watch for the right listing.

One build era, one clear read
Because Cypress Park Tarpon was built out entirely between 2002 and 2005, buyers are not weighing early-2000s construction against decades-older or brand-new stock in the same community — the comparison set is narrow and consistent. That makes condition, updates, and maintenance history the main differentiators between listings rather than era of construction itself.
No community amenities are identified from current MLS listings, so this reads as a straightforward residential subdivision rather than an amenity-driven community. Buyers drawn here are typically evaluating the home and lot on their own terms, not weighing clubhouse, pool, or recreational features into the decision.
